Exploring the Mystical Beauty of Mussoorie

Thursday, August 10: Arrival in Mussoorie

Arrive in the serene hill station of Mussoorie and check-in to your hotel. In the morning, take a leisurely stroll along the Mall Road, the heart of Mussoorie, lined with charming shops and restaurants. Enjoy panoramic views of the Doon Valley from Gun Hill, accessible by cable car. For the afternoon, visit Kempty Falls, a picturesque waterfall where you can take a refreshing dip. As the evening sets in, head to Landour Bazaar and indulge in some local street food.

  • Mall Road: Free, 2 hours
  • Gun Hill: INR 75 per person (cable car), 1 hour
  • Kempty Falls: INR 20 per person, 3 hours
  • Landour Bazaar: Food expenses, 2 hours
Friday, August 11: Exploring Landour

Start your day with a visit to Lal Tibba, the highest point in Mussoorie, offering breathtaking views of the snow-capped Himalayas. In the afternoon, explore the charming hill station of Landour, known for its colonial-era architecture. Visit Char Dukan, a cluster of four shops offering delectable snacks and hot beverages. Take a leisurely walk along the Camel's Back Road, surrounded by lush greenery. Enjoy a peaceful evening at the serene St. Paul's Church.

  • Lal Tibba: Free, 2 hours
  • Char Dukan: Food expenses, 1 hour
  • Camel's Back Road: Free, 2 hours
  • St. Paul's Church: Free, 1 hour

Hidden Gems and Local Favorites

For those seeking off the beaten path attractions, explore the enchanting Jharipani Falls, located amidst lush forests. Take a hike to the beautiful Mossy Falls, hidden away in the pristine nature of Mussoorie. Visit Cloud End, a tranquil spot away from the tourist crowds, offering panoramic views of the Himalayas. Discover the fascinating history of Mussoorie in the Mussoorie Heritage Centre. Don't miss out on the local specialty, "Momos," steamed dumplings stuffed with delicious fillings.
